input::-webkit-inner-spin-button,input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}.hero_careers:before{width:min(280px,70%)!important;top:3.5rem!important}@media(max-width:768px){.hero_careers:before{top:2.75rem!important;width:min(240px,80%)!important}}.career{display:grid;grid-template-columns:40% 60%;grid-gap:45px;gap:45px;padding:20px;width:100%;max-width:1120px;margin:60px auto 80px}@media(max-width:1279px){.career{grid-template-columns:1fr;padding:1rem clamp(1rem,4vw,2rem)}.career,.career .image{width:100%}}.career .career_textSection{display:flex;flex-direction:column;justify-content:center}.career .career_textSection h1{margin-bottom:20px;position:relative;font-size:clamp(2rem,-.3323rem + 5.988vw,2.5rem);z-index:1;background-color:transparent}.career .career_textSection h1:before{content:"";width:100%;height:20px;position:absolute;top:2.2rem;left:0;background-image:url(/_next/static/media/Subtract.eb6fd78d.svg);background-repeat:no-repeat;z-index:-1}.career .career_textSection p{margin-bottom:30px;font-size:16px;font-weight:400;line-height:24px;letter-spacing:-.01em;text-align:left}.career .career_textSection button{background-color:#d91e23;border:2px solid #d91e23;color:#fff;width:40%;padding:8px 24px;border-radius:32px}.career .career_textSection button a{color:#fff;font-size:16px;font-weight:600;line-height:24px;letter-spacing:-.01em;text-align:left}@media(max-width:768px){.career .career_textSection button{width:80%}}